Program Director Full Time Brooklyn, NY, US The Program Director is responsible for supervising the shelter/program under his/her jurisdiction. This includes supervision of personnel, facility management, fiscal management, client services, liaison with funding sources, and community relations. Adhere to and comply with ALL contract requirements. The essential functions of the job include but are not limited to the duties listed in the job description.
D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
Exercise overall responsibility for the safe operation and effective results of all program operations at the facility Maintain a healthy and safe environment for residents and staff while ensuring that residents all are moving towards attainment of independent living, or an appropriate living status beyond the Tilden Hall Residence shelter. Operate the facility and programs within the approved limits established by the annual budget. Serve as the primary program liaison to DHS. Work alongside the Human Resources Department in 1) adhering to the HR Policies and Procedures established in the Employee Handbook and 2) the selection process in filling vacant positions. Responsible for maintaining effective communication and interaction with staff in all areas of the shelter while ensuring the staff receives the necessary training and professional development that will equip them to be successful in their job descriptions. Assure the shelter remains in compliance with City and State regulations and that the program and the facility are maintained at a level of excellence that will surpass the requirements of all inspections. Assess program needs and identify potential funding streams to enhance services. Serve as liaison to local service providers and community leaders to ensure a good relationship with the community. Assure that the physical environment of the shelter is maintained and respond to quality assurance questions in a timely manner. Ensure shelter maintains its contractual compliance regarding program goals and objectives. Direct supervision of the following personnel: Social Services Director, Client Care Coordinator Supervisor, Security Supervisor, Childcare Supervisor, Intake Specialist and Maintenance Facility Manager.PERSONNEL AND FACILITY MANAGEMENT

Qualifications A minimum of 7-10 years’ successful experience in the fields of: services to homeless people; clinical social work with medically frail, mentally ill, or at-risk populations; or in senior-level shelter administration. In addition, successful experience with budget management is strongly desired. Skills of a Shelter Director: Excellent computer skills including proficiency in Microsoft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Cares and ADP Workforce now platform or similar platforms. Strong verbal and written communication skills, with emphasis on face-to-face, empathetic communication with shelter residents. Exceptional leadership skills in dealing with both staff and residents coupled with a personal commitment to serving the poor and disadvantaged. Experience with MICA. Mentally ill and chemical abuse. Master’s degree or higher in Social Work, Mental Health Counseling, Non-profit Operations Nursing, Public Health, Public Policy, or a related field with a related License. A minimum of 3 to 5 years post-masters work experience in the behavioral health and criminal justice field with progressively increasing responsibilities, preferably with the target population Knowledge of mental illness and serious emotional disturbances and substance use disorders In depth knowledge of NYC behavioral health and community support programs and systems Knowledge of homeless resources, NYC shelter systems, and MTA transit systems Experience working with homeless and precariously housed populations.
